How Does Cloud Hosting Support the Use of Automation or Configuration Management Tools?

Cloud hosting can support the use of automation or configuration management tools by providing access to a reliable, secure environment for running these tools and allowing for scalability and flexibility in terms of resource allocation.

Cloud hosting can provide tremendous support for using automation or configuration management tools. By leveraging cloud computing, organizations can automate tasks and processes that would otherwise be time-consuming and labor-intensive.

Cloud hosting makes deploying and managing complex configurations across multiple servers easier. This article will explore how cloud hosting supports the use of automation or configuration management tools and the benefits these tools offer to businesses.

Automation

Automation uses technology to automate tasks that are done manually. In cloud hosting, automation can streamline processes such as provisioning and configuring servers, deploying applications, and managing infrastructure.

Automation tools allow users to set up their cloud environment with minimal effort quickly. For example, a user could use an automation tool to create multiple virtual machines in a matter of minutes instead of manually configuring each one individually.

Automation tools can help ensure that all components configure correctly and consistently across different environments. This helps reduce errors and improves reliability when deploying applications or services on the cloud platform.

Configuration Management

Configuration management is the process of managing and maintaining a system’s configuration. This ensures implementations are correct specifically in tracking changes to the system, ensuring that all components are up-to-date, and ensuring that any new arrangements are.

Cloud hosting can support this process by providing an environment where these tools can manage and maintain the system’s configuration. With cloud hosting, users have access to a wide range of automation and configuration management tools, allowing them to quickly deploy applications or make changes without manually configuring each component.

These tools also provide visibility into how the system works so that administrators can quickly identify any potential issues or areas for improvement. Organizations can use automation/configuration management tools with cloud hosting to ensure their systems remain secure and reliable while reducing the manual effort required for maintenance tasks.

Cloud Hosting

Cloud hosting is web hosting that uses cloud computing technology to store and manage data. Instead of relying on physical hardware, cloud hosting stores data in virtual servers hosted on the internet.

This allows for greater scalability and flexibility than traditional web hosting solutions, as users can easily add or remove resources as needed. Cloud hosting also provides improved security, reliability, and performance compared to other types of web hosting.

When using automation or configuration management tools with cloud hosting, these tools allow users to quickly deploy applications and services across multiple servers without having to configure each server individually or manually.

Automation/configuration management tools are designed specifically for use with cloud-based infrastructure. They have various uses compared to traditional methods such as manual scripting or SSH commands.

These tools provide an easy way for developers and system administrators to manage their applications in the cloud environment by automating tasks such as provisioning new servers, configuring software packages, deploying code updates, monitoring resource usage, etc.
